When I decided to be a bit more serious I did a lot of reading etc. and I got the feeling I wanted some rather heavy darts so after some more searching I settled for the Harrows Savage 85% 27 gram darts and they felt very nice and not heavy at al. But the more I throw I got more curious about other types and weights of darts, so my 2nd pair of darts was the Winmau Mervyn King 90% 22 gram and it was the look that made me buy them (not the best decision making Guests cannot see images in the messages. Please register at the forum by clicking here to see images. ) but they are ok darts just that I didn’t manage to throw them straight they always hit with an angle.
I had the opportunity to try some Target Stephen Hunting 90% 12 grams and they were the best dart I had tried so far and that surprised me since they are so light… I even bought my own set and like them a lot. And a couple of days ago I saw the Winmau Ted Hankey 14 grams in a store and I bought them Guests cannot see images in the messages. Please register at the forum by clicking here to see images. When I started to throw them I was a bit disappointed since I also had problem to throw them straight… What I decided to do was to change the shaft to a shorter, Target Pro Grip 42 mm and now I can throw them straighter… I was a bit surprised that the shaft had such a big impact on the darts… So they are now my favorite darts Guests cannot see images in the messages.
